Swope Community Builders Leadership
Barrett Hatches
President
As President of Swope Community Builders and Chief Operating Officer of Swope Community Enterprises, Barrett Hatches is responsible for overseeing comprehensive development projects and civic investment totaling more than $500 million.
Prior to his current position, Hatches was president and CEO of Northern Indiana Public Service Company, Northern Indiana Fuel & Light Company and Kokomo Gas & Fuel Company in Merrillville, Ind. Previous experience also includes senior management positions with SEMCO Energy in Port Huron, Michigan and Anchorage, Alaska, where he served as president and CEO of ENSTAR Natural Gas, and with North American Salt Company and Missouri Gas Energy, both in Kansas City.
Hatches earned a Master of Arts in Management from Webster University in St. Louis, Mo. and a Bachelor of Arts in Political Science from Jackson State University in Jackson, Miss. He was named one of Kansas City’s 100 Most Influential African-Americans in 1994.

John Crawford
Vice President, Planning and Development
In his role as Vice President of Planning, John Crawford brings over 25 years of economic development experience to Swope Community Builders. Crawford is responsible for developing and managing redevelopment programs utilizing public/private partnerships. During his tenure, Swope Community Builders has managed the largest CDC-driven redevelopment program in Kansas City, Mo. the public/private, TIF-funded reinvestment program for Kansas City’s Brush Creek Corridor.
A graduate of Worcester State College and Virginia Polytechnic Institute, Crawford has served as President of the Applied Urban Research Institute and as Executive Director for three redevelopment agencies in Kansas City, Mo. Crawford has been selected to present his expertise to numerous groups, including Urban Land Institute and National Council for Urban Economic Development (CUED). He has been an adjunct faculty member at the University of Kansas University, University of Missouri-Kansas City and Park University.

Naimish Patel
Vice President, Finance
Naimish Patel is responsible for overall financial management of Swope Community Builders. Patel oversees all budgeting, planning and business decision support analysis. In addition, Patel provides financial analysis in support of strategic planning for the organization.
Patel’s expertise includes a diversity of experiences including serving as Chief Financial Officer of a highly successful managed care plan in Kansas City. Patel earned his bachelor of Business Administration from the SP University in Nagar, India. He is a graduate of University of Missouri-Kansas City earning a Master of Business Administration degree. He is a Certified Public Accountant. Patel is a member of the Health Care Financial Management association and American Institute of Certified Public Accountants.
